About Georgia Gwinnett College

Georgia Gwinnett College is a public four-year institution located in Lawrenceville, Georgia. With an enrollment of approximately 11,156 undergraduate students, it is a mid-size institution. With an acceptance rate of 96%, the institution maintains an accessible admissions process. The graduation rate is 20%. Graduates earn a median salary of $47,730 within 10 years of enrollment. After financial aid, the average student pays a net price of $11,696 per year.
